Mission

To provide access to clean water and to continue to support well communities.

Programs

3 programs

Menstrual hygiene program that includes: instructional workshops, distribution of reusable products, soap and underwear to 2,056 girls and 171 women living in remote villages.

Expenses: $65K

Variety of educational programs that provide support to samburu children, including: school fees for five samburu elementary school students, mentorship and computer assistance to secondary school students seeking college scholarships.

Expenses: $60KGrants: $10K

An agricultural program for tsp well partner schools, including construction of one school garden and planning of 2 more.

Expenses: $14K
